diff --git a/README.md b/README.md index ad67357c..ea682e79 100644 --- a/README.md +++ b/README.md @@ -38,14 +38,17 @@ You have complete control over what goes into your resume, how it looks, what co - Bengali (বাংলা) - Chinese (中文) +- Danish (Dansk) - English - French (Français) - German (Deutsch) - Hindi (हिन्दी) - Italian (Italiano) - Kannada (ಕನ್ನಡ) +- Polish (Polski) - Spanish (Español) - Tamil (தமிழ்) +- Turkish (Türkçe) Help by [translating Reactive Resume](https://translate.rxresu.me) to your language! diff --git a/client/config/languages.ts b/client/config/languages.ts index 00b8754a..28831d63 100644 --- a/client/config/languages.ts +++ b/client/config/languages.ts @@ -5,55 +5,19 @@ export type Language = { }; export const languages: Language[] = [ - { - code: 'bn', - name: 'Bengali', - localName: 'বাংলা', - }, - { - code: 'zh', - name: 'Chinese', - localName: '中文', - }, - { - code: 'en', - name: 'English', - }, - { - code: 'fr', - name: 'French', - localName: 'Français', - }, - { - code: 'de', - name: 'German', - localName: 'Deutsch', - }, - { - code: 'hi', - name: 'Hindi', - localName: 'हिन्दी', - }, - { - code: 'it', - name: 'Italian', - localName: 'Italiano', - }, - { - code: 'kn', - name: 'Kannada', - localName: 'ಕನ್ನಡ', - }, - { - code: 'es', - name: 'Spanish', - localName: 'Español', - }, - { - code: 'ta', - name: 'Tamil', - localName: 'தமிழ்', - }, + { code: 'bn', name: 'Bengali', localName: 'বাংলা' }, + { code: 'da', name: 'Danish', localName: 'Dansk' }, + { code: 'de', name: 'German', localName: 'Deutsch' }, + { code: 'en', name: 'English' }, + { code: 'es', name: 'Spanish', localName: 'Español' }, + { code: 'fr', name: 'French', localName: 'Français' }, + { code: 'hi', name: 'Hindi', localName: 'हिन्दी' }, + { code: 'it', name: 'Italian', localName: 'Italiano' }, + { code: 'kn', name: 'Kannada', localName: 'ಕನ್ನಡ' }, + { code: 'pl', name: 'Polish', localName: 'Polski' }, + { code: 'ta', name: 'Tamil', localName: 'தமிழ்' }, + { code: 'tr', name: 'Turkish', localName: 'Türkçe' }, + { code: 'zh', name: 'Chinese', localName: '中文' }, ].sort((a, b) => a.name.localeCompare(b.name)); export const languageMap: Record = languages.reduce( diff --git a/client/next-i18next.config.js b/client/next-i18next.config.js index d4ee5bf5..ae899498 100644 --- a/client/next-i18next.config.js +++ b/client/next-i18next.config.js @@ -3,7 +3,7 @@ const path = require('path'); const i18nConfig = { i18n: { defaultLocale: 'en', - locales: ['bn', 'de', 'en', 'es', 'fr', 'hi', 'it', 'kn', 'ta', 'zh'], + locales: ['bn', 'da', 'de', 'en', 'es', 'fr', 'hi', 'it', 'kn', 'pl', 'ta', 'tr', 'zh'], }, nsSeparator: '.', localePath: path.resolve('./public/locales'), diff --git a/docs/docs/index.mdx b/docs/docs/index.mdx index eaabfb55..4549518f 100644 --- a/docs/docs/index.mdx +++ b/docs/docs/index.mdx @@ -46,14 +46,17 @@ You have complete control over what goes into your resume, how it looks, what co - Bengali (বাংলা) - Chinese (中文) +- Danish (Dansk) - English - French (Français) - German (Deutsch) - Hindi (हिन्दी) - Italian (Italiano) - Kannada (ಕನ್ನಡ) +- Polish (Polski) - Spanish (Español) - Tamil (தமிழ்) +- Turkish (Türkçe) Help by [translating Reactive Resume](https://translate.rxresu.me) to your language!